📅  最后修改于: 2023-12-03 15:38:10.521000             🧑  作者: Mango
在 CSS 中,每个 HTML 元素都有一些默认的样式。这些样式称为默认填充,它们定义了元素的边框、内边距和外边距等属性。而如果我们需要自定义 div 元素的边距和填充,就需要删除它默认的填充了。
我们可以使用 CSS 的 margin(外边距)和 padding(内边距)属性来删除 div 的默认填充。具体方法如下:
div {
margin: 0;
padding: 0;
}
上面的代码会将 div 元素的填充和边距都设置为 0,从而删除默认的填充。
reset.css 是一个常用的样式表,在 HTML 中引入它可以删除所有默认样式和重置所有元素的属性。如果我们只需要删除 div 元素的默认填充,我们可以使用以下代码:
div {
margin: 0;
padding: 0;
}
* {
box-sizing: border-box;
}
上面的代码会将 div 元素的填充和边距都设置为 0,然后将所有元素的 box-sizing 属性设置为 border-box。这个属性会将元素的宽度和高度包括边框和内边距,从而消除默认填充对布局的影响。
通过以上两种方法,我们可以删除 div 元素的默认填充,从而自定义元素的边距和填充。使用 reset.css 可以一次性重置所有元素的默认样式,而手动设置 margin 和 padding 属性则更具针对性,可以更好地控制元素的外观。